Mike Tyson got $30m for infamous ear-biting fight – then blew $1.15m in a day

The day before Mike Tysons infamous rematch against Evander Holyfield in Las Vegas in June 1997, the heavyweight boxer went to collect his pay check at the office of his promoter, Don King, at the MGM Grand. A grinning King pulled out a pen and wrote a check, which he held up for Tyson to see.
The sum? $30 million — and all before the boxer had even fought.
“I’ll see you tomorrow night,” King told Tyson. “Now, just don’t get into any trouble tonight, my brother. Just keep it calm.”
